California was counting on Facebook tax revenue to make up for an expected shortfall due to other businesses leaving the state to avoid higher taxes. The state heavily relies on its corporate and personal income tax system to fund its budget. State tax collections fell by $6.1 billion, or down 11%, versus the same period in 2011.
